#cbc583 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cbc583 is composed of 79.6% red, 77.3%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3% magenta, 35.5%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 55 degrees, a saturation of 40.9% and a lightness of 65.5%. #cbc583 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#978b07.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#cbc583 color description : Slightly desaturated yellow.

#cbc583 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cbc583 has RGB values of R:203, G:197,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.03, Y:0.35,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13354371.

Shades and Tints of #cbc583

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f9f9f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cbc583

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a9a9a5 is the less saturated color, while #faec54 is the most saturated one.
